Searched refs:GroupRecord (Results 1 – 3 of 3) sorted by relevance
68 static const GroupRecord OptionTable[] = {75 llvm::StringRef GroupRecord::getName() const { in getName()79 GroupRecord::subgroup_iterator GroupRecord::subgroup_begin() const { in subgroup_begin()83 GroupRecord::subgroup_iterator GroupRecord::subgroup_end() const { in subgroup_end()87 llvm::iterator_range<diagtool::GroupRecord::subgroup_iterator>88 GroupRecord::subgroups() const { in subgroups()92 GroupRecord::diagnostics_iterator GroupRecord::diagnostics_begin() const { in diagnostics_begin()96 GroupRecord::diagnostics_iterator GroupRecord::diagnostics_end() const { in diagnostics_end()100 llvm::iterator_range<diagtool::GroupRecord::diagnostics_iterator>101 GroupRecord::diagnostics() const { in diagnostics()[all …]
39 struct GroupRecord { struct50 friend struct GroupRecord; argument88 typedef group_iterator<GroupRecord> subgroup_iterator; argument104 llvm::ArrayRef<GroupRecord> getDiagnosticGroups(); argument107 inline GroupRecord::subgroup_iterator::reference108 GroupRecord::subgroup_iterator::operator*() const {113 inline GroupRecord::diagnostics_iterator::reference114 GroupRecord::diagnostics_iterator::operator*() const {
39 static bool unimplemented(const GroupRecord &Group) { in unimplemented()46 static bool enabledByDefault(const GroupRecord &Group) { in enabledByDefault()52 for (const GroupRecord &GR : Group.subgroups()) { in enabledByDefault()60 void printGroup(const GroupRecord &Group, unsigned Indent = 0) { in printGroup()73 for (const GroupRecord &GR : Group.subgroups()) { in printGroup()88 ArrayRef<GroupRecord> AllGroups = getDiagnosticGroups(); in showGroup()95 const GroupRecord *Found = llvm::lower_bound(AllGroups, RootGroup); in showGroup()107 ArrayRef<GroupRecord> AllGroups = getDiagnosticGroups(); in showAll()110 for (const GroupRecord &GR : AllGroups) { in showAll()